linux端口占用怎么处置惩罚
linux端口占用处置惩罚要领:使用netstat下令找出占用端口的历程。使用kill下令竣事占用端口的历程。修改效劳设置文件中的端口号。使用端口转发将端口转发到其他端口或主机。使用防火墙规则阻止对特定端口的会见。使用reincarnate工具自动检测端口占用并重新启动占用端口的效劳。
Linux端口占用处置惩罚
在Linux系统中,端口占用可能导致效劳无法启动或泛起其他问题。处置惩罚端口占用有以下要领:
1. 查找占用端口的历程
netstat -tulnp | grep LISTEN
登录后复制
这将列出所有监听端口的历程。
2. 竣事占用端口的历程
获取历程ID (PID) 后,可以使用以下下令竣事历程:
kill -9 PID
登录后复制
3. 修改端口号
若是该端口对特定效劳至关主要,则可以修改效劳设置文件中的端口号。例如,关于Apache,可以在/etc/apache2/ports.conf文件中更改端口号。
4. 使用端口转发
若是端口关于外部应用程序很主要,则可以使用端口转发(port forwarding)将该端口转发到其他端口或主机。例如,使用SSH端口转发:
ssh -L local_port:remote_host:remote_port user@remote_host
登录后复制
这将将外地端口local_port转发到远程主机remote_host的端口remote_port。
5. 使用防火墙规则
防火墙可以用来阻止对特定端口的会见。例如,使用iptables建设防火墙规则:
iptables -A INPUT -p tcp --dport PORT -j DROP
登录后复制
这将阻止对端口PORT的TCP毗连。
6. reincarnate 工具
reincarnate是一个工具,可以自动检测端口占用并重新启动占用端口的效劳。要装置它,请使用:
sudo apt-get install reincarnate
登录后复制
要使用它,请在/etc/reincarnate.conf文件中设置要监视的端口,并启动该效劳:
sudo systemctl start reincarnate
登录后复制
以上就是linux端口占用怎么处置惩罚的详细内容,更多请关注本网内其它相关文章!